Rakwal Population - Gurdaspur, Punjab

Rakwal is a medium size village located in Pathankot Tehsil of Gurdaspur district, Punjab with total 82 families residing. The Rakwal village has population of 365 of which 193 are males while 172 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Rakwal village population of children with age 0-6 is 31 which makes up 8.49 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Rakwal village is 891 which is lower than Punjab state average of 895. Child Sex Ratio for the Rakwal as per census is 550, lower than Punjab average of 846.

Rakwal village has higher literacy rate compared to Punjab. In 2011, literacy rate of Rakwal village was 78.44 % compared to 75.84 % of Punjab. In Rakwal Male literacy stands at 84.39 % while female literacy rate was 72.05 %.

Caste Factor

Rakwal village of Gurdaspur has substantial population of Schedule Caste.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 25.21 % of total population in Rakwal village. The village Rakwal curr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Rakwal village out of total population, 109 were engaged in work activities. 99.08 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 0.92 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 109 workers engaged in Main Work, 27 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 13 were Agricultural labourer.
